Terms of Trade (TOT) is an important indicator used to reveal the change of a country's benefit from its trade, which is deeply concerned by every economy. This paper analyzes the changes in China's terms of trade with the background of economic globalization.After brief comments on the main developments and debates about TOT theory, this paper discusses the changes of China's terms of trade during different period based on 1980-2004 data. Result shows that the TOT of China is going to deteriorate in long run. The trend of manufactured goods'TOT has played a main role.Industrial structure, exchange rate regime, and foreign investment are the main factors that influence the changes of Chinese TOT. This paper analyzes mainly the industrial structure and trade mode evolution, and so on. Based on that, some problems are pointed out about China's industrial structure and trade structure, and respective policy suggestions are put forward. Then, the investigation is made to show how the Chinese TOT affected by RMB appreciating. Finally, this paper expatiates the effect mechanism of FDI inflow on China's TOT.At the end of the paper, a number of recommendations have been put forward to improve our TOT, and trade efficiency. Such as rely on technological progress to improve the industrial structure, improve its efficiency to guide the flow of foreign capital, and attention to avoid exchange rate risks.
